The analog inputs are galvanically isolated from the supply voltage (PELV) and other high-voltage ter-
minals.

The pulse and encoder inputs (terminals 29, 32, 33) are galvanically isolated from the supply voltage
(PELV) and other high-voltage terminals.
1) Pulse inputs are 29 and 33
2) Encoder inputs: 32 = A, and 33 = B
3) Terminal 29: Only FC 302
